Getting to know Kuljit Mann

My approach to mental health follows a holistic and wellness model. I use an egalitarian process that involves a shared decision-making model. Everyone is different and unique; therefore, the treatment plan will be customized to fit your individual needs and goals. I utilize strategies such as holistic care, mindfulness, and an innovative approach called "geek therapy" to help clients build personal insight. By incorporating topics like anime, video games, and DnD, I engage individuals through their personal interests, making the process more meaningful and wholesome. I hold a Master's in Psychiatric Mental Health Nursing from New York University, which informs my practice and commitment to evidence-based care. What should a new client know about working with you?

*IMPORTANT before booking, please note the following* Korey is available for clinical diagnosis evaluation, medication management and some therapy for 30 minute follow ups once a month & sooner for regimen changes - Unaccepted plans: Medicaid, Medicare, Community, ACA or ny.gov marketplace plans - We do not see clients seeking treatment for: Schizophrenia, Schizoaffective disorder, Psychosis, medical injectables - We do not prescribe daily benzodiazepine medications or exceedingly high doses of stimulants due to long term health risks - We are licensed to practice in New York state. If meeting via telehealth/virtual, laws require the client to be physically located in New York state. Please find a setting that is quiet, private & stationary - For New York residents: if we prescribe a controlled substance medication, DEA regulations require an in-person visit at least once a year - For New Jersey residents only: before a controlled substance medication can be filled, an in-person visit is required. In addition in-person visits are required every 3 months - To be considered for FMLA or work/school/other accommodations, you must be an ongoing client adhering to treatment plan *View accepted insurances + onboarding information below*

What is your typical process for working with clients?

At Mindflow Psychiatry we have an in-depth 1 hour first session to determine your treatment plan and goals. Together we design a process that works for you, often implementing therapy with combination of medications as needed. Follow up cadence is dependent on fit, clinical recommendation & availability.
